Scott C. Amick

Scott C. Amick, 66 of Scott City, Missouri died Sunday, March 24 at his home.  He was born September 25, 1957 in Cape Girardeau to Olliver Charles and Betty Jo St. Clair Amick.  He married Leann Miller in November 10, 2011.

Scott was a 1976 graduate of ISC and a 1979 graduate of Kentucky School of Mortuary Science. He was an owner/partner of Amick-Burnett Funeral Chapel along with Mark S. Amick and Jack Leslie Burnett serving the community for forty-two years, He served as Scott County Coroner for thirty-five years where he was past president of Missouri Coroners and Medical Examiners Association, a member of Missouri Funeral Directors Association.  was also a 4th Degree Knight of Columbus, served twenty years on the Scott City School Board and reffed High School Basketball for fifteen years, avid Cardinal fan, avid runner participating in many 5K races and announced and kept clock for many a Scott City football game.
